1. 15 Aug, 2019 1 commit
  2. 18 Jun, 2019 1 commit
  3. 03 Jun, 2019 1 commit
  4. 28 Sep, 2018 1 commit
  5. 20 Sep, 2018 1 commit
  6. 10 Sep, 2018 1 commit
  7. 31 May, 2018 1 commit
    • Greg Kroah-Hartman's avatar
      USB: fotg210-hcd: no need to check return value of debugfs_create functions · 9b10516f
      Greg Kroah-Hartman authored
      
      
      When calling debugfs functions, there is no need to ever check the
      return value.  The function can work or not, but the code logic should
      never do something different based on this.
      
      Cc: Felipe Balbi <felipe.balbi@linux.intel.com>
      Cc: Alan Stern <stern@rowland.harvard.edu>
      Cc: Johan Hovold <johan@kernel.org>
      Cc: Kuppuswamy Sathyanarayanan <sathyanarayanan.kuppuswamy@intel.com>
      Cc: Vasyl Gomonovych <gomonovych@gmail.com>
      Cc: Mariusz Skamra <mariuszx.skamra@intel.com>
      Cc: "Gustavo A. R. Silva" <garsilva@embeddedor.com>
      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
      9b10516f
  8. 24 Jan, 2018 1 commit
  9. 07 Dec, 2017 1 commit
  10. 07 Nov, 2017 1 commit
    • Greg Kroah-Hartman's avatar
      USB: host: Remove redundant license text · ba2e73bb
      Greg Kroah-Hartman authored
      
      
      Now that the SPDX tag is in all USB files, that identifies the license
      in a specific and legally-defined manner.  So the extra GPL text wording
      can be removed as it is no longer needed at all.
      
      This is done on a quest to remove the 700+ different ways that files in
      the kernel describe the GPL license text.  And there's unneeded stuff
      like the address (sometimes incorrect) for the FSF which is never
      needed.
      
      No copyright headers or other non-license-description text was removed.
      
      Cc: Felipe Balbi <felipe.balbi@linux.intel.com>
      Cc: Johan Hovold <johan@kernel.org>
      Signed-off-by: default av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
      ba2e73bb
  11. 04 Nov, 2017 1 commit
  12. 01 Nov, 2017 1 commit
  13. 03 Jun, 2017 1 commit
  14. 16 Mar, 2017 1 commit
  15. 28 Feb, 2017 1 commit
  16. 25 Dec, 2016 2 commits
    • Thomas Gleixner's avatar
      ktime: Cleanup ktime_set() usage · 8b0e1953
      Thomas Gleixner authored
      
      
      ktime_set(S,N) was required for the timespec storage type and is still
      useful for situations where a Seconds and Nanoseconds part of a time value
      needs to be converted. For anything where the Seconds argument is 0, this
      is pointless and can be replaced with a simple assignment.
      Signed-off-by: default avatarThomas Gleixner <tglx@linutronix.de>
      Cc: Peter Zijlstra <peterz@infradead.org>
      8b0e1953
    • Thomas Gleixner's avatar
      ktime: Get rid of the union · 2456e855
      Thomas Gleixner authored
      
      
      ktime is a union because the initial implementation stored the time in
      scalar nanoseconds on 64 bit machine and in a endianess optimized timespec
      variant for 32bit machines. The Y2038 cleanup removed the timespec variant
      and switched everything to scalar nanoseconds. The union remained, but
      become completely pointless.
      
      Get rid of the union and just keep ktime_t as simple typedef of type s64.
      
      The conversion was done with coccinelle and some manual mopping up.
      Signed-off-by: default avatarThomas Gleixner <tglx@linutronix.de>
      Cc: Peter Zijlstra <peterz@infradead.org>
      2456e855
  17. 09 May, 2016 1 commit
  18. 25 Jan, 2016 1 commit
  19. 09 Nov, 2015 1 commit
  20. 18 Oct, 2015 1 commit
  21. 17 Oct, 2015 8 commits
  22. 04 Oct, 2015 2 commits
  23. 07 Apr, 2015 1 commit
  24. 03 Apr, 2015 1 commit
  25. 25 Jan, 2015 1 commit
  26. 20 Nov, 2014 1 commit
  27. 24 Sep, 2014 1 commit
  28. 09 Jul, 2014 1 commit
  29. 09 Dec, 2013 1 commit
  30. 03 Dec, 2013 2 commits